Instructions:
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
Place potato slices in a greased baking dish. Drizzle with olive oil, sprinkle with salt, black pepper, and 1/2 teaspoon sweet paprika.
Bake for 20 minutes until potatoes begin to soften.
Meanwhile, in a skillet over medium heat, sauté onions and ground beef with salt, black pepper, 1/2 teaspoon sweet paprika, and oregano until browned.
Add peeled tomatoes and simmer for 10 minutes.
Pour beef mixture over precooked potatoes. If using, sprinkle mozzarella cheese on top.
Bake for an additional 15 to 20 minutes until cheese is puffed and golden.
Serve warm from the oven.
